Biomass Boilers
Biomass boilers use wood pellets, chips or logs to develop heat and hot water. They are a great option for off-grid buildings or those that wish to get off the gas grid.

As a standalone heater, biomass can give adequate power to keep your home cozy all the time without the regular warm drop off of other renewable technologies. They can additionally be utilized in conjunction with solar panels to increase savings and benefit from RHI repayments.

A disadvantage of these systems is the ahead of time cost and routine gas distributions. Typically, pellets will need to be blown right into a gas shop using a vacuum system or they can be manually fed right into the central heating boiler through a hopper. Logs are generally self-sourced from nearby woodland or gotten wholesale. In addition to this, they require hand-operated loading and might need cleaning on a regular basis.
